🗺️3-Day Itinerary:
Day 1:
📍Ciguang Pavilion: It’s recommended to take the Yuping Cableway up the mountain, about 10 minutes one way, cableway ticket 90 RMB/person
📍Welcoming Pine: The iconic landmark of Huangshan, a must-visit photo spot📸
📍Tiandu Peak: The most dangerous peak of Huangshan, but definitely worth the climb (Note: open from April to November)
📍Baiyun Hotel: Recommended to stay in the starry sky room, where you can lie down and watch the stars through a full glass window🌌
-
Day 2:
📍Bright Summit Peak: The second highest peak of Huangshan, an excellent spot for sunrise viewing🌅
📍West Sea Grand Canyon: Recommended to enter from the north entrance and exit from the south entrance, about 4 hours total, don’t miss the popular little train ride!
📍Paiyun Pavilion: Best place to shoot the sunset in the evening
📍Beihai Hotel: Nearby are many century-old pine trees, try to find the "Dream Pen Blossoms"
-
Day 3:
📍Shixin Peak: Many of Huangshan’s strange pines are here
📍Bai’e Ridge: A hotspot for sea of clouds, if lucky you can see the "Cotton Candy Sea of Clouds"☁️
📍Yungu Cableway down the mountain: Recommended to descend before 3 PM to avoid peak return traffic

🍜Food Recommendations:
✅Huangshan Shaobing (baked flatbread): Be sure to buy freshly baked ones! Recommended at "Fangxin Yu Maodoufu" on Old Street
✅Stinky Mandarin Fish: The authentic recipe at Yunhua Building Restaurant is amazing! Located on Tangkou Town Commercial Street
✅Mao Tofu: Unique texture, remember to pair with spicy sauce
-
⚠️Practical Tips:
1️⃣Big temperature difference on the mountain, recommend bringing a windbreaker and quick-dry innerwear
2️⃣Bring trekking poles, they are cheap at 3 RMB each at the foot of the mountain
3️⃣For hot springs, choose Piaoxue Hot Spring to experience the contrast of ice and fire
4️⃣"Two different worlds on and off the mountain," be sure to plan cableway times well
5️⃣Book accommodation at least 2 weeks in advance, especially on weekends and during peak season
